Top 10 Tips to Succeed in Selenium Training and Master Automation






Selenium has become the go-to tool for test automation, and mastering it can significantly enhance your career in quality assurance. Whether you are a beginner or looking to upgrade your skills, Selenium training in Chennai provides the perfect opportunity to dive deep into automation testing. Here are the top 10 tips to help you succeed in your Selenium training journey:

  1. Start with the Basics: Before jumping into complex concepts, it's crucial to understand the fundamentals of automation and Selenium’s key components like WebDriver, IDE, and Grid.

  2. Set Up Your Environment: Ensure you properly set up your testing environment by installing Selenium and configuring it with browsers like Chrome, Firefox, or Edge. Learning the setup process during training lays the foundation for practical implementation.

  3. Master Locators: One of the core skills is identifying web elements. Spend time learning how to effectively use locators like XPath, CSS Selectors, and ID to interact with web elements. This is key for writing reliable tests.

  4. Write Modular Code: During Selenium training, focus on writing modular code by breaking tests into smaller functions. This practice helps with reusability and makes your code more maintainable.

  5. Understand Object-Oriented Concepts: Selenium tests are often written in programming languages like Java or Python, so understanding object-oriented programming (OOP) concepts is crucial for writing clean and efficient test scripts.

  6. Work with Different Web Elements: Selenium training in Chennai will teach you how to handle different web elements like dropdowns, buttons, text fields, and dynamic elements. Get hands-on experience working with these elements to make your tests more robust.

  7. Automate Multiple Browsers: Learn to execute your tests across multiple browsers and environments. Selenium allows cross-browser testing, ensuring that your web application works seamlessly on different platforms.

  8. Learn to Handle Dynamic Data: Real-world applications often use dynamic data that changes over time. Master techniques like waiting strategies (explicit, implicit) to handle dynamic content and improve test reliability.

  9. Integrate with Test Frameworks: To efficiently manage and execute your Selenium tests, integrate them with test frameworks like TestNG or JUnit. This helps in test case management, reporting, and parallel execution.

  10. Apply Knowledge with Projects: The best way to learn is by doing. Apply what you’ve learned in Selenium training in Chennai through real-world projects. This practical experience solidifies concepts and prepares you for professional challenges.


By following these tips and committing to your Selenium training in Chennai, you’ll not only master Selenium but also gain valuable skills that can boost your career as a test automation engineer. Keep practicing, stay updated with the latest tools and techniques, and soon you’ll be an expert in Selenium automation testing.




Leave a Reply

Your email address will not be published. Required fields are marked *